Transaction ff63b5adfee79142f8089dc3dfd9622e49baf156b121b8c9a0a9e4fcf501ef28

9 Input
2 Outputs
  • ff63b5adfee79142f8089dc3dfd9622e49baf156b121b8c9a0a9e4fcf501ef28:0
  • value  433059
    address  bc1qw856sja3wt2x9tpgu4kyhph4lyshvydcyxe7xq
  • ff63b5adfee79142f8089dc3dfd9622e49baf156b121b8c9a0a9e4fcf501ef28:1
  • value  15164185
    address  3BkQKdeWvXhKG4pP1SrL93Bt9sBJN9LyFX